web-dev-qa-db-ja.com

Ionic-phonegap-Push-pluginの追加/削除-CocoaPodsが見つかりませんでした

Ionicアプリを書いていますが、非常に多くの問題が発生しています。特に1つの問題は、コマンドを使用してphonegap-Push-pluginを追加しようとすることです

Sudo ionic plugin add phonegap-plugin-Push

次のエラーが表示されます。

Error: CocoaPods was not found. Please install version 1.0.1 or greater from https://cocoapods.org/

エラーが示唆するように私は明らかにこのソフトウェアをインストールしようとしましたが、バージョン1.0.1はどこにも見つかりません。

また、これが何のために必要なのか、なぜIonicが必要と考えるのかを理解したいと思います。

どうもありがとう

23
Martin Crawley

Pushをインストールするには、最初にcocoapodsをインストールする必要があります。端末のIonicプロジェクトディレクトリで次の手順を実行します。

最初にインストールしようとしたものを削除します

ionic cordova plugin remove phonegap-plugin-Push

次にココアポッドをインストールする

Sudo gem install cocoapods

次に、cocoapodsリポジトリを同期する必要があります

pod setup

これは時間がかかる場合があります

最後にPushをインストールします

ionic cordova plugin add phonegap-plugin-Push --variable SENDER_ID="XXXXXXX"
70
Matt

「Sudo」なしで試してください:cordova plugin add phonegap-plugin-Push --variable SENDER_ID = "XXXXXXX"

詳細: ここ

1
Andrei Lupu